Figure 5From: The contribution of peroxynitrite generation in HIV replication in human primary macrophagesMnTBAP inhibits nitrotyrosine formation in HIV-infected macrophages. Photomicrographs (optical microscopy) of nitrotyrosine staining in HIV-1-infected macrophages. HIV-1 infection enhance the immunocytochemical expression of nitrotyrosine (Panel A) in compared to mock-infected macrophages (Panel B), indicating an increased production of peroxynitrite. Acute treatment with MnTBAP (30 μM) (Panel D), but not with AZT (0.05 μM) (Panel C) is able to inhibit in macrophages HIV-related peroxynitrite formation.Back to article page
